Hansoft upgrades integration SDK

Hansoft has upgraded the Hansoft integration SDK, adding a .NET layer.

The SDK allows the data and functionality on the Hansoft server to integrate with the studio’s toolchain or other external systems. At present, the SDK features a C layer and the new .NET layer, with C++ support soon to be released.

"With our SDK it’s easy to integrate Hansoft for project management and bug tracking with other leading tools to create a tightly woven
best-of-breed solution for application lifecycle management," said Patric Palm, managing director of Hansoft.

Cameron Dunn, technical director at IR Gurus – a studio that uses Hansoft’s project management and QA system – added: "The Hansoft integration SDK is an important part of our workflow design. The SDK is an absolute joy to work with. I wish all companies had such nice interfaces to their products."
